WebNov 18, 2024 · 10 Yuki-onna. Photo credit: Sawaki Suushi. Just because she’s pretty doesn’t mean you should ask her in for a drink. Yuki-onna (“snow woman”) is a myth with apparent sightings documented as far back as the 14th century. WebOct 19, 2024 · Nine-tailed foxes are commonplace in folktales originating from Korea, China, and Japan.
